
If you ever believed for one second that Ocho Cinco was going to sit out the entire season, you are probably the same person who thinks that Roger Clemens never used steroids. So it wasn't surprising to me in the least the Chad declared he would be attending training camp.
The situation is eerily similar to the Terrell Owens Eagles fiasco. Here's why. Chad is absolutely correct in his assessment of the Bengals organization, but because he can't keep his mouth from running 100 MPH. he can't get his wish to be traded or get a new contract. Chad's coming to training camp will probably be more distracting than if he would have stayed away.
In the end, just like the Eagles, if the Bengals continue to be hard-headed. they will fail and the team will struggle. Eventually Chad will get released, suspended, traded, or cut. He will get his money with another team and the Bengals will be worse off for it. They should have taken that 1st round pick from the Redskins when they had the chance.
